Down syndrome is a condition caused by chromosomal abnormality with:

Down syndrome is a condition caused by chromosomal abnormality with: (a) Physical characteristics (b) Mental Retardation (c) Both a & b (d) None ✅ Correct option: (c) Both a & b Explanation: Down syndrome affects both physical traits and cognitive development.
